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in Data Analytics, Engineering, Computer Science, or a related technical field.
Experience in Engineering, Manufacturing, or Quality in defense products and/or complex production process management.
3+ years of experience in a technical data role such as Data Engineer, Analytics Engineer, or BI Engineer.
Proven experience building and maintaining data pipelines and/or analytics models in a platform like Palantir Foundry, Databricks, or a similar cloud environment.
Proficiency in SQL for querying and analyzing large, complex datasets across multiple systems.
Proficiency in Python for data transformation and scripting (e.g., using Pandas, PySpark).
Responsibilities
Support & Maintain Data Analytics:
Support basic analytics and investigation utilizing existing tools and capabilities. Direct users to utilize analytic dashboards, troubleshoot existing dashboard accuracy, and provide modification & improvements to increase dashboard effectiveness.
Investigate Data Quality:
Act as a lead technical investigator for data quality issues. When a dashboard is inaccurate or data seems wrong, you will perform deep-dive analysis using SQL and Python to trace the problem back to its source and identify the root cause.
Troubleshoot & Optimize:
Support the analytics team by troubleshooting data access issues, improving pipeline performance for faster dashboard loads, and ensuring the overall health and reliability of the quality data ecosystem in Foundry.
